Output 21b786555aaa678821ceeac038395adc8b6b1e9f006566dd92b12c27150d587f:123

value
503617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 475d43667e9d025c7a5d335a8cf2ad67ec24ada4 OP_EQUAL
address
38CMdD9ModqccckNR3u15VA7wS2pa12D8Z
transaction
21b786555aaa678821ceeac038395adc8b6b1e9f006566dd92b12c27150d587f
spent
true